Как може да се подобри ефективността на архитектурата в управляваните от данни архитектури?

Има няколко начина за подобряване на ефективността на архитектурата в управляваните от данни архитектури:

1. Използвайте подходящи решения за съхранение на данни: Изберете подходящи решения за съхранение на данни, които могат да обработват ефективно големи количества данни. Например, Hadoop Distributed File System (HDFS) може да се използва за съхраняване на големи набори от данни, докато релационните бази данни могат да се използват за съхраняване на структурирани данни.

2. Оптимизирайте алгоритмите за обработка на данни: Оптимизирайте алгоритмите за обработка на данни чрез използване на алгоритми за машинно обучение, техники за паралелна обработка и техники за компресиране на данни. Това може да помогне за намаляване на времето за обработка на данни и подобряване на ефективността на системата.

3. Внедрете кеширане на данни: Внедрете техники за кеширане на данни, за да подобрите производителността при извличане на данни. Чрез кеширане на често достъпни данни системата може да намали необходимостта от многократно извличане на данни от по-бавни устройства за съхранение.

4. Мащабна архитектура: Мащабната архитектура може да бъде внедрена за обработка на големи набори от данни без компромис с производителността. В тази архитектура системата може да бъде разширена чрез добавяне на повече сървъри и единици за съхранение, ако е необходимо.

5. Прилагане на разделяне на данни: Разделянето на данни помага за разпределяне на натоварването между множество сървъри или единици за съхранение, като по този начин намалява тесните места в системата.

6. Балансиране на натоварването: Могат да бъдат внедрени техники за балансиране на натоварването, за да се разпределят равномерно натоварванията между множество сървъри, намалявайки натиска върху всеки един сървър.

7. Наблюдавайте производителността на системата: Наблюдавайте производителността на системата с подходящи инструменти за анализ и наблюдение на предупреждения. Чрез наблюдение на системата е възможно да се идентифицират и разрешат проблеми, преди те да повлияят на производителността.

Дата на публикуване: